AI UGC Ads
The teams winning on TikTok and Reels right now test 15–20 creative variants per product. At $150–500 per creator video, almost nobody can afford that — which is exactly why generated UGC ads work. AgentMedia produces realistic creator-style video ads from a script in about a minute each, keeps the same AI actor across every variant, and publishes straight to your channels.
The creative-testing playbook
1. Write hooks, not briefs
Five first-lines beat one polished script. "I keep getting DMs about..." outperforms "Introducing our new..." every time.
2. Generate a variant per hook
One CLI command or API call per variant. Same character, different opening — about a minute each.
3. Test, kill, scale
Push variants as organic posts or Spark Ads, kill the losers in 48 hours, and regenerate around the winning angle.
Batch 20 variants from one file
# hooks.csv: one ad hook per line
while IFS= read -r hook; do
agent-media selfie \
--character char_a1b2c3d4e5 \
--script "$hook" \
--scene-action "holding the product to camera, casual bedroom light" \
--duration 10
done < hooks.csvOr do the same through the REST API from your own pipeline — webhook back when each render finishes.
Frequently asked questions
- What are AI UGC ads?
- Video ads that look like authentic creator content — a real-seeming person talking to camera about a product — generated entirely by AI. They run as TikTok Spark Ads, Instagram Reels ads, and YouTube Shorts placements, where polished studio creative underperforms.
- Why do UGC-style ads outperform studio creative?
- Feed-native content earns more watch time, and watch time drives delivery. UGC-style ads typically see lower CPMs and higher hook rates than produced spots on TikTok and Reels. The catch has always been production volume — which is the part AgentMedia automates.
- How fast can I test new ad angles?
- Each video takes about a minute to generate. Write five hooks, generate five variants, push them live the same morning. With the API or CLI you can batch-generate from a CSV of hooks and let your agent iterate on whatever wins.
- Does AgentMedia publish the ads too?
- It auto-publishes organic posts to TikTok, Instagram, YouTube, and X — useful for creative testing via Spark Ads. For paid campaigns, download the finished MP4 (no watermark) and upload it to your ads manager.
- Can I keep the same actor across a campaign?
- Yes. Persist a character once and reference it in every generation — the face, energy, and style stay consistent across all your ad variants.
Test 20 angles before lunch
Generate, publish, and iterate UGC ads from one command — plans from $39/mo, no watermarks.
Get started freeRelated: Best UGC tools compared · UGC video guides · TikTok UGC ads